Understanding Brain Boosting

The brain is like a muscle. The more you use it in targeted ways, the stronger it gets. Brain boosting games target specific cognitive functions: memory, attention, processing speed, and reasoning. When these functions improve, overall cognitive performance goes up.

Memory Boosting Games

Memory Card Match

The classic matching game trains visual memory. Start simple and increase difficulty. We have many themed sets and my kids challenge themselves to beat their records.

Kim Game

Place objects on a tray, study them, then remove one. What is missing? This directly trains working memory capacity. We play this before bed every night.

Story Memorization

Memorize short poems or story passages. Recite them together. This develops verbal memory and language skills. My kids can now recite several poems from memory.

Attention Boosting Games

Jigsaw Puzzles

Puzzles require sustained attention to detail. Start with large-piece puzzles and work up to more complex ones. The concentration developed transfers to other activities.

Spot the Difference

Compare two similar pictures and find all differences. This trains visual attention and detail processing. Start with obvious differences and work up to subtle ones.

Listening Games

Identify specific sounds in a noisy environment. This trains auditory attention. We play this on walks: what can you hear right now?

Processing Speed Games

Timed Challenges

Give simple tasks under time pressure. How fast can you sort these cards? How quickly can you find the matching pairs? The urgency trains rapid processing.

Quick Recall

Flash facts or images briefly and ask questions. How many did you see? What color was the car? This trains rapid information processing.

Pattern Completion

Show incomplete patterns and complete them quickly. This trains visual processing speed and pattern recognition.

Reasoning Games

Chess and Checkers

Strategy games require planning, prediction, and evaluation. These games develop logical reasoning and strategic thinking. Start young and progress gradually.

Logic Puzzles

Age-appropriate logic puzzles develop deductive reasoning. What comes next? Which one does not belong? These questions train logical thinking.

Sudoku

Number puzzles develop logical reasoning and pattern recognition. Start with picture Sudoku for young kids and work up to number versions.

Creative Brain Games

Storytelling

Create stories together. This develops creative thinking, narrative skills, and the ability to make connections between ideas.

Art Challenges

Give creative constraints: draw with only straight lines, make art only from circles. Constraints force creative thinking.

Invention Challenges

Imagine a new invention that solves a problem. What would it look like? How would it work? This develops innovation thinking.

Final Thoughts

Brain boosting games are not about drilling. They are about engaging cognitive functions in challenging, enjoyable ways. Start with one or two games per cognitive area. Practice regularly. The improvements will come gradually but surely.
